## Changelog — Graphspindle 4.2.0

Changed defaults for the dependency graph visualizer. Max render depth lowered from unlimited to 6; cycles now collapse into a single badge node instead of expanding. Layout engine default switched from radial to layered. Edge labels off by default for graphs over 200 nodes. Cache TTL for resolved graphs shortened to reduce stale views reported by the Tellerby team. No API changes; only defaults. Reviewer: confirm the diff matches the new effective configuration shown below.

deployment values, yadug-bawif:
[framir]
team = pelox
access_code = ac_a38ab2
owner = tamion.julael
host = framir.tolvaqlabs.test
port = 11211
peer = tammir.zemvargrid.local
salt = 2215ef03
pin = 1541

**Break-Glass: Receipt Mailer (Oakhollow)**

If the donation-receipt mailer stalls and donors report missing receipts, support may invoke break-glass access to the Oakhollow mailer console. Use only when the mailer team is unreachable and the backlog exceeds one hour. Log the incident immediately after. Console access requires the break-glass passphrase below.

vault phrase of bagaf-kajeg = jorath-feniel-briir-siliel-ralix

Leadership Review Briefing — Logistics Provider Change

For sales leads: we are moving distribution from Carsten Freight to Ambervale Logistics effective next quarter. Drivers for the change are service reliability on the Norfield corridor and a consolidated rate card covering all three regional hubs. Expect a two-week transition window with buffered stock at depots; customer delivery promises remain unchanged. Escalation routes will be circulated separately. The commercial rationale is outlined in the confidential note below.

confidential, kagep-kahof: Druokax Systems plans to lower the Ulaath list price by 53 percent in March.